First off, let's understand what unitized seals are. Unitized seals are essentially integrated sealing solutions. They combine multiple sealing elements into a single unit, which is designed to provide a more efficient and reliable sealing performance. These seals are used in a wide range of industries, from automotive to aerospace, and they play a crucial role in preventing fluid leakage and protecting equipment from contaminants.

Now, the big question: do unitized seals have long - term stability? Well, the answer is a bit complex, but in most cases, yes, they do. There are several factors that contribute to their long - term stability.

Material quality is one of the most important factors. The materials used in unitized seals need to be able to withstand the harsh conditions they'll be exposed to over time. For example, in automotive applications, seals may have to deal with high temperatures, pressure, and exposure to various chemicals. High - quality rubber and other polymers are commonly used in unitized seals because they offer excellent resistance to these factors.

Another factor that affects long - term stability is the design of the unitized seal. A well - designed seal will distribute stress evenly across its surface, reducing the risk of premature failure. For instance, the shape and dimensions of the seal are carefully calculated to ensure a proper fit and to minimize the amount of stress on any one part of the seal.

However, it's important to note that the long - term stability of unitized seals can be affected by external factors. For example, improper installation can lead to premature failure. If a seal is not installed correctly, it may not be able to form a proper seal, which can result in leaks and reduced performance over time. The operating environment is another external factor. If a seal is exposed to extremely harsh conditions, such as very high temperatures or corrosive chemicals, its lifespan may be shortened. But even in these challenging environments, unitized seals can still offer good long - term performance if they are made from the right materials and are properly designed.
